Presented to the Virginia Beach City Council
WHEREAS Virginia Beach 2007 residential real estate assessments have increased by an average of 21.4 percent, and
WHEREAS annual real estate tax increases have risen more than six times greater than the increase in the Consumer Price Index, and
WHEREAS Section 58.1-3321 of the Code of Virginia requires that when any annual assessment of real property would result in an increase of 1 percent or more in the total real property tax levied, the city shall reduce its rate of levy for the forthcoming tax year so as to cause such rate of levy to produce no more than 101 percent of the previous year's real property tax levies, and
WHEREAS Section 2-186.1 of the Municipal Code of the City Of Virginia Beach requires the city manager to prepare an annual budget using no more than the previous fiscal year's real estate tax levies plus any additional real estate revenues resulting from new development, and
WHEREAS we citizens of Virginia Beach require our City Council to be good stewards of our public funds,
NOW THEREFORE BE IT RESOLVED that the City Council of Virginia Beach shall establish a revised tax rate of no more than $0.78 per hundred dollars of assessed value for all residential real estate property for the 2007-2008 tax year. Be it further resolved that all future real estate tax increases shall be limited to the increase in the Consumer Price Index.
